Publisher Description:
They all wanted the relic. The Interstellar Union of Civilized Peoples wanted a weapon out of legend, one that could crush planets and smash suns, to give it the control over the planets of men it so grandly claimed. The Orion colonies wanted to keep the relic out of the hands of the Stellar Union. The Society of Truth wanted to separate truth from legend, as was its mission; knowledge that might save the universe was merely a bonus. Acey Transit was as interested in winning a hand of solitaire as he was in searching the middle of nowhere for a rock that wasn't just a rock. But he found it - and unfriendly ships in firing range. Against long odds, Sudden Smith wanted to survive another starship battle with most of his body intact - and to reconcile with the woman of his dreams. Christopher Marlowe Paxton wanted his too-expensive convoy to return safely, his daughter to reconcile with the captain of the ship on escort duty (if he returned safely), and war to hold off until Autarchia was ready. Facing the end of the world - her world - by an unstoppable alien invasion, the Planetary Director of Whistlestop, only wanted a small favor. You can't always get what you want.
